body {
font-size: 12px;
font-family: Comic Sans MS;
}

a {
font-size: 12px;
font-family: Comic Sans MS;
text-decoration: underline;
}

ul {
padding-left: 25px;
}

#kontener {
position: relative;
margin: 0 auto;
top: 0px;
width: 729px;
height: 100%;
padding-top: 90px;
}

#menu {
background-image: url('grafika/menu_tlo.png');
background-repeat: repeat-y;
width: 180px;
}

#menu_gora {
background-image: url('grafika/menu_gora.png');
background-repeat: no-repeat;
width: 180px;
}

#menu_reszta {
position: relative;
top: 70px;
left: 10px;
width: 165px;
font-size: 12px;
color: black;
padding-left: 7px;
}

#menu_reszta a {
font-size: 12px;
text-decoration: none;
color: black;
}

#menu_reszta img {
padding-right: 5px;
}

.submenu {
    overflow: hidden;
}

.submenu span {
    padding: 5px 0;
    text-indent: 10px;
    display: block;
}

.submenu a:hover {
display: block;
background: #FFDA2B;
}

#menu_dol {
background-image: url('grafika/menu_dol.png');
background-repeat: no-repeat;
width: 180px;
height: 81px;
}

#logo {
position: absolute;
left: 556px;
top: 1px;
z-index: 100;
float: right;
}

.akapit {
padding: 8px 0px;
text-indent: 1cm;
}